Spectators killed at US car race
At least eight people have been killed and 12 injured at an off-road motor race in California, reports say.
A vehicle crashed into a crowd of spectators at the California 200 desert night race near Lucerne Valley, 100 miles (160km) from Los Angeles.
Many of the injured were airlifted to hospital, officials told the AP news agency.
The California 200 is a race for powerful, all-terrain vehicles over a 50 mile (80km) off-road track.
